If PS has the same system ticket system as Squad then:
- 1 player is worth 1 ticket, one tank can be worth 15 tickets, each vehicle has a respawn timer which can reach 15min,
- side that runs out of tickets first loses,
Additionally one-manning vehicles that require multiple crew to operate will get you kicked on most servers. Doing "kamikaze run at the enemy lines" can be considering asset waste and will most likely get you kicked from the server, example would be some noob pilot practicing flying helis in public server crashing one after another.

So yeah, if you got kicked you most likely deserved it.
